About SubtitleGenerator

SubtitleGenerator is a browser-based tool that takes a video from AI transcription to a publish-ready subtitle file or video export without leaving one editor. It launched this week and targets creators who work with subtitles directly from their browser. The free tier allows 60 one-minute videos per month with no signup required.

Review

SubtitleGenerator combines transcription, editing, translation, and export into one workflow. The tool flags uncertain words for review and shows a running count until the transcript hits "All clear," which gives editors a defined endpoint. It's aimed at solo creators and small teams who want to avoid jumping between separate transcription and editing tools.

Key Features

  • Fix flow: flags uncertain source words, shows remaining review count, and displays "All clear" when the transcript is finished
  • 30 subtitle styles included across all plans
  • Full-track translation on Pro and Max plans, keeping the original language subtitles intact
  • Eight subtitle formats available for export on paid tiers
  • Browser-based processing: the original video stays in the browser; only extracted audio is sent for transcription and deleted afterward

Pricing and Value

The Free plan includes 60 one-minute videos per month, 720p export with a small watermark, and all 30 styles. Pro and Max add high-accuracy transcription, full-track translation, HD export without watermark, eight subtitle formats, custom fonts, and saved brand styles. A pay-as-you-go option exists for users who need more subtitle time without a subscription. Speaker labels and manual corrections are planned for v2 but are not available yet.

Pros

  • Free tier is unusually generous: 60 one-minute videos monthly with no signup
  • Fix flow gives a clear finish line instead of leaving uncertain words scattered through the transcript
  • Translation keeps the original language track intact
  • Privacy design keeps the source video in the browser; only audio is transmitted
  • All styling options are available on the free plan

Cons

  • No speaker labels yet; overlapping speech in interviews or podcasts requires manual work
  • HD export and custom fonts require paid plans
  • Not well suited for editors who need multi-speaker transcription with labels today, since that feature is still in development

SubtitleGenerator fits best for solo creators producing tutorials, voiceovers, or short social clips in one language, where the free tier covers a regular output schedule. Teams needing speaker-separated transcripts for podcast or interview edits should wait for v2 labeling, or use a separate transcription tool alongside it. The pay-as-you-go option makes it practical for occasional bursts of work without committing to a subscription.
